The Reality About Sugar and Cavities



You should know that sugar intake is a major factor to dental cavity.

When you consume sugary foods and drinks, the microorganisms in your mouth eat the sugars and produce acids. These acids assault the enamel, the safety external layer of your teeth, causing it to weaken and break down gradually.

As the enamel deteriorates, tooth cavities begin to create. Regularly enjoying Recommended Reading treats and consumes alcohol can dramatically raise your risk of developing dental cavity.

It's important to limit your sugar intake and method good dental health to preserve healthy teeth. Brushing twice a day, flossing daily, and seeing your dentist consistently for exams can help avoid cavities and maintain your smile intense and healthy and balanced.

Exposing the Misconception of Cleaning Harder for Cleaner Pearly Whites



Don't think the myth that brushing harder will certainly lead to cleaner teeth. Many individuals believe that using more stress while brushing will remove more plaque and germs from their teeth. Nonetheless, this isn't true, and as a matter of fact, it can be hazardous to your dental wellness.

Brushing too hard can damage your tooth enamel and irritate your periodontals, causing sensitivity and gum recession. The trick to effective cleaning isn't force, but method and uniformity.

It's suggested to make use of a soft-bristled toothbrush and gentle, round movements to clean all surfaces of your teeth. Additionally, cleaning for at the very least two minutes two times a day, along with routine flossing and dental check-ups, is necessary for preserving a healthy and balanced smile.

Common Dental Myths: What You Required to Know



Do not be deceived by the misconception that sugar is the major offender behind tooth decay and tooth cavities.

While it holds true that sugar can add to oral issues, it isn't the single reason.



Dental cavity happens when unsafe bacteria in your mouth prey on the sugars and starches from the foods you consume.

These bacteria create acids that wear down the enamel, resulting in dental caries.

However, inadequate oral health, such as inadequate brushing and flossing, plays a substantial role in the growth of tooth decay too.

Furthermore, certain aspects like genetics, completely dry mouth, and acidic foods can likewise contribute to oral concerns.
